  Most heart transplant recipients: Duke Medicine breaks Guinness World Records' record (VIDEO)


DURHAM, N.C., USA -- Duke Medicine have broken a Guinness World Records' record by hosting the largest gathering of heart transplant recipients ever; a record-setting 189 heart transplant recipients along with families, doctors and hospital staff gathered at the Washington Duke Inn for food and discussion,
setting the new world record for the Most heart transplant recipients, according to the World Record Academy: www.worldrecordacademy.com/ .
Duke Medicine have broken a Guinness World Record by hosting the largest gathering of heart transplant recipients ever Sunday. The event?held to celebrate the more than 1,000 heart transplants conducted at Duke Medicine since the program began in 1985?was planned after the 1,000th transplant earlier this year. The Guinness World Records' record for the largest gathering of heart transplant recipients is 132 and was achieved by Donate Life Coalition of Michigan (USA) at the Art Moran Buick GMC, Southfield, Michigan, USA, on 14 February 2014.

   Duke started performing heart transplants in 1985. Now, 60 to 65 heart transplants are performed each year. The high transplant volume is just one reason why Duke is ranked among the nation's top five heart programs by U.S. News & World Report this year.

  Many of the recipients who gathered to help Duke celebrate have returned to normal lives after their transplant. At least one has become a competitive athlete. All who attended expressed their gratitude to the doctors, nurses and staff who make every heart transplant success possible.
